Grimes and the Sixers are reportedly still far apart on a multi-year deal with the qualifying-offer deadline fast approaching.
From Grimes' perspective, of course, settling for the qualifying offer is hardly ideal from a long-term security perspective, though in the short term it provides him with a no-trade clause and the ability to hit unrestricted free agency in a year.
